    Dodgers signed infielder Olmedo Saenz to a minor league contract.
    If the Dodgers sign a left-handed-hitting first baseman, Saenz might be able to make the team as a pinch-hitter and starter against left-handers. The former Athletic is currently batting .324 with a 947 OPS in 40 games in Puerto Rico.

    Olmedo Saenz went 3-for-5 with a homer, a double and six RBI tonight in the Dodgers’ 12-6 win over the Pirates.
    It was Saenz’s first start in four games, and he probably wouldn’t have played if not for Jason Phillips’ bruised hand. Ricky Ledee also got a start tonight and went 3-for-5 with a homer. If manager Jim Tracy is going to resume playing some of his better hitters, maybe the Dodgers will win a few more games.

    Olmedo Saenz, rehabbing from a torn Achilles’ tendon, is considering retirement.
    Saenz went 0-for-4 in his first start at Single-A Modesto this week but hasn’t played since. Manager Ken Macha said Saenz had returned to Arizona for ''personal reasons’’ and that his rehab was on hold.
